..RIGHT TO APPEAL DECISION
Persons who are dissatisfied with a decision of the City Council may have the dght to a review of that decision
by a court. The City has adopted Section 1094.6 of the California Code of Civil Procedure which generally
limits to ninety (90) days the time within which the decision of the City Boards and Agencies may be judicially
challenged.

AUDIENCE COMMENTS ON NON-AGENDA ITEMS
The City Council welcomes input from the audience. If there is a matter of business on the agenda
that you are interested in, you may address the Council when this matter is considered. If you wish
to speak on a matter that is not on this agenda, you may do so at this time. In order for everyone to
be heard, please limit your comments to three (3) minutes per person and not more than ten (10)
minutes per subject. The Brown Act regulations do not allow action to be taken on audience
comments in which the subject is not listed on the agenda.
